Background and Classification
Rainbow Sangria is generally discussed as a hybrid cannabis variety. Hybrid strains are developed by combining genetic traits from different cannabis lineages, with the goal of producing specific characteristics such as appearance, aroma, growth patterns, and chemical profiles.
Because strain names are not always standardized across the industry, different producers may use the same name for products with different genetic backgrounds. Therefore, information about lineage and characteristics may differ between sources.Rainbow Sangria Strain

Aroma and Flavor Profile
The aromatic profile of a cannabis strain is influenced by naturally occurring compounds called terpenes. These compounds contribute to the scent and flavor characteristics found in different varieties.Rainbow Sangria Strain
Descriptions associated with Rainbow Sangria often reference combinations of fruity, sweet, and herbal notes. However, the exact aroma profile can vary depending on cultivation conditions, curing methods, and the specific plant genetics involved.Rainbow Sangria Strain
Terpene Information
Terpene profiles are unique chemical combinations that differ between cannabis varieties. Common terpenes discussed in cannabis research and industry descriptions include:Rainbow Sangria Strain
- Myrcene — commonly associated with earthy and herbal aromas
- Limonene — often linked with citrus-like scent characteristics
- Caryophyllene — known for spicy and pepper-like aromatic qualities
- Pinene — associated with pine-like aromas
A laboratory analysis is the most reliable way to determine the actual terpene composition of a specific sample.Rainbow Sangria Strain

Appearance and Physical Characteristics
Rainbow Sangria is generally described in strain discussions as having visually appealing flower characteristics. Descriptions often focus on features such as dense bud structure, varied coloration, and visible trichome coverage. These traits are influenced by genetics, growing conditions, environmental factors, and post-harvest handling.
Color expression in cannabis flowers can be affected by natural pigments called anthocyanins, which may contribute to shades ranging from green to purple hues. However, appearance alone does not determine chemical composition or overall quality.

Strain Classification
Cannabis strains are often described using categories such as indica, sativa, or hybrid. These classifications are widely used in consumer and industry discussions, although modern research suggests that a strain’s effects and characteristics are more closely connected to its chemical profile rather than traditional labels alone.
Cannabinoids, terpenes, and individual biological differences all contribute to how cannabis varieties are experienced and understood.
